Transaction 5323e5971a4a0373f83337cdf988bb17c6838102514d945a86d9286dd57baad6

4 Input
2 Outputs
  • 5323e5971a4a0373f83337cdf988bb17c6838102514d945a86d9286dd57baad6:0
  • value  301570
    address  194J4JJC9BbZBjrcvc29CbowW5Tz4xin4W
  • 5323e5971a4a0373f83337cdf988bb17c6838102514d945a86d9286dd57baad6:1
  • value  987493
    address  3Fa9EYkjfia7opnJSWT8box5DFYK4KLRVY